About the team
Amazons vision for the future is one where Fulfillment Centers operate as a local store with up to 60 of flows for each DS will come from a single upstream FC. We envision Amazons Outbound Supply chain to be the benchmark for Performance Speed and Cost and do not believe in prioritizing one service over the other. The ideal network design is one that lowers costtoserve and in the process does so with a positive impact on delivery speed and reliability.
The Network Optimization & Regional Design (NORD) Teams mission is to create the roadmap to enable this vision and drive crossfunctional initiatives to make rapid progress towards it. The team will work across the breadth of the Supply Chain to identify opportunities to improve placement make better fulfillment decisions and guide the development of the right infrastructure and network design to bring it all together.
